You may find yourself giving so much to others while quietly running on empty. Stress, conflict, and daily pressures can weigh heavily, leaving you feeling exhausted and disconnected. I provide a calm, restorative space to process what you are carrying and explore practical strategies for relief. As founder of Golden Hour Counselling, and as a Registered Clinical Counsellor (RCC) and Canadian Certified Counsellor (CCC), I support clients with ADHD, anxiety, trauma, stress, anger, addiction, grief, depression, relationship concerns, low self-worth, burnout, boundaries, life transitions, and parenting.
Many clients come to strengthen family life. This might look like easing parenting stress, navigating co-parenting, or restoring balance at home. I offer a warm therapeutic environment to reflect and explore practical strategies, informed by advanced training in ADHD, DBT, and trauma therapy. My approach is calm and grounded in trust and meaningful change.
I am also a father, which deepens the way I understand the struggles of showing up for others while staying connected to yourself. Whatever you are carrying, therapy provides a grounded place to feel heard, understood, and to explore new ways forward. Together we can connect in person or virtually to foster resilience, growth, and meaningful change.
